Born in a political family, his father was a union minister and later became the Chief Minister of Delhi. |
His grandmother celebrated his birth by saying, 'Bete ka pravesh ho gaya,' leading to his naming. |
Originally had a family name of Lakra that was changed to Verma for electoral reasons. |
Once got separated from his family during a trip to Mumbai at a young age but was reunited the next day. |
Survived a blast incident while returning from a Jagran, witnessing injuries and fatalities. |
Electrocuted while playing cricket as a child, narrowly escaping serious harm. |
Changed schools seven times in twelve years, facilitated by his father's connections. |
Once forged his father's signature and got caught, receiving a scolding for it. |
Despite being curious, he quit smoking bidi after being reprimanded by his father. |
Had consistently high academic performance as a student. |
Active in various sports during his school years and played multiple games competitively. |
Joined the Rashtriya Swayamsevak Sangh (RSS) in his teenage years and took on leadership roles. |
Pushed into a political career after his father's untimely death in a car accident. |
Achieved significant electoral victories in both local and national elections. |
Known for his social service contributions through multiple NGOs. |
Organized initiatives supporting women, education, and disaster relief in various regions. |
